Understanding Auto Insurance Requirements in NJ
In New Jersey, drivers are required to have a minimum level of auto insurance coverage. Understanding these requirements can help you make informed decisions when searching for the best cheap auto insurance NJ has to offer.
Mandatory Coverage Types
- Liability Insurance: Covers bodily injury and property damage to others in an accident you cause.
- Personal Injury Protection (PIP): Covers medical expenses for you and your passengers, regardless of fault.
- Uninsured Motorist Coverage: Protects you if you're in an accident with an uninsured driver.
Tips for Finding Affordable Auto Insurance
There are several strategies you can employ to lower your auto insurance premiums without sacrificing coverage.
Compare Multiple Quotes
It's crucial to compare quotes from different insurance providers. Websites like auto care insurance can be a valuable resource for comparing rates and finding discounts.
Consider Usage-Based Insurance
Usage-based insurance programs track your driving habits and can lead to significant savings if you are a safe driver.
Look for Discounts
- Good Driver Discounts
- Multi-Policy Discounts
- Safety Feature Discounts
Common Mistakes to Avoid
When searching for cheap auto insurance in NJ, avoid these common pitfalls:
Ignoring the Fine Print
Always read the policy details carefully to understand what is covered and what is not.
Choosing the Lowest Price
While price is important, the cheapest policy may not offer the best coverage. Consider the balance between cost and protection.

FAQ Section
What is the minimum car insurance requirement in New Jersey?
New Jersey requires a minimum of liability insurance, personal injury protection, and uninsured motorist coverage.
How can I lower my auto insurance premiums?
You can lower premiums by comparing multiple quotes, opting for usage-based insurance, and taking advantage of available discounts.
Are there penalties for not having car insurance in NJ?
Yes, driving without insurance in New Jersey can result in fines, license suspension, and even jail time.
